BBC Sports Personality Of The Year
Candidates
Mark Cavendish - Cycling
Darren Clarke - Golf
Alastair Cook - Cricket
Luke Donald - Golf
Mo Farrah - Athletics
Dai Greene - Athletics
Amir Khan - Boxing
Rory Mcllroy - Golf
Andy Murray - Tennis
Andrew Strauss - Cricket.
There are no footballers on the list of candidates this time but the big controversy is the lack of any women!

Andy Murray was last night crowned as the BBC's sports personalty of the year following his historic Wimbledon triumph last summer.
Welsh rugby player Lee Halfpenny was 2nd and Jockey Tony McCoy who has now ridden 4,000 winners came 3.
The British Lions rugby side won the team award for their series victory against Australia down under.
